Overview
Defelsko Positector6000 series imported Coating thickness gauge is a coating thickness measuring instrument widely used in various industries. This series of products adopts magnetic and eddy current thickness measurement principles, which are divided into advanced and standard types. Different models are provided for ferrous and non-ferrous metal substrates, which are simple, durable, accurate, multi-purpose and powerful.

Principle
The Positector6000 series Coating thickness gauge uses magnetic Induction and eddy current measurement principles to automatically identify ferrous or non-ferrous metal substrate types and make accurate measurements.

Standards
ISO 2718/2360/2808, PrEN ISO 19840, ASTM B499/D1186/D1400/D7091/E376/G12, BS3900-C5, SSPC-PA2 and Miscellaneous
Steps
1. Select the appropriate Probe type according to the measurement requirements (such as universal close-fitting Probe, 90 ° Probe, 0 ° Probe, 45 ° micro Probe, 90 ° micro Probe, thick coating special Probe).
2. Place the thickness gauge Probe vertically on the surface of the coating to be tested.
3. Read the Film thickness measurement on the display screen.
4. Advanced instruments can connect computers and printers via USB or Bluetooth for data transmission, and use scan mode, SSPC/PA2 or PSPC90/10 functions for data analytics.
Notice
• Please select the appropriate instrument model or Probe according to the substrate type (ferrous F, non-ferrous N or all metal FN) before measurement.
• Ensure that the Probe is in good contact with the coated surface for accurate readings.
• Although the instrument host has a chemical-resistant and dust-proof design, it is still necessary to avoid long-term immersion or extreme environment use.
• There are differences between the advanced type and the standard type in display, storage capacity and advanced functions (such as Bluetooth, graphical display), please choose according to actual needs.
• The calibrating method includes zero, one and two point calibrating, please calibrate appropriately according to the measurement requirements.
